ABS-like resin combines resin-printing detail with higher strength and toughness reminiscent of ABS plastic. The part crumbles less and handles impact and bending better, making it suitable for functional jobs that brittle standard resin cannot do.
What it is good for
- Functional prototypes that get test-fit and loaded
- Parts with threads, snaps, thin but strong features
- Housings and holders needing both accuracy and strength
- Master models that get machined
Where NOT to use it
- Parts under high heat — heat resistance is moderate (use high-temp resin)
- Flexible items — ABS-like is rigid (use flexible resin)
- Outdoor items under constant UV
- When cheap standard resin is enough for static decor
How to print
- Normal layer exposure: close to standard resin, dialed in with a test
- Bottom layer exposure: 25–45 s
- Layer height: 0.03–0.05 mm
- Cure wavelength: 405 nm
- ABS-like is often more sensitive to over-exposure — an under-exposure test helps find the balance
Washing, curing and storage
- Washing: 3–6 minutes in isopropyl alcohol (IPA)
- UV curing: moderate — ABS-like over-cures easily and turns brittle. Shorter but more even is better
- Storage: in a dark, tightly sealed bottle
- Stir before printing
Pros and cons
- Stronger and tougher than standard resin
- Keeps good detail
- Suitable for functional parts
- Can be machined
- More expensive than standard resin
- Over-cures into brittleness easily
- Moderate heat resistance
- Same liquid-resin toxicity
